Ingredients for Healthy Thanksgiving The Ultimate Smash Burger
Okay, burger lovers – let’s talk ingredients! This isn’t one of those “throw whatever’s in the fridge” situations. Here’s exactly what you’ll need to make these Thanksgiving smash burgers sing:
- The star: 1 lb lean ground beef (90% lean) – trust me, that extra leanness makes all the difference
- Flavor boosters: 1 tsp olive oil,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, ½ tsp black pepper, ½ tsp salt
- Bun situation: 4 whole wheat burger buns – lightly toasted, of course
- Fresh crunch: 1 cup mixed greens, 1 tomato (sliced thin), ¼ cup red onion (thin slices only – no big chunks!)
- Saucy business: ¼ cup low-fat mayonnaise, 1 tbsp mustard (I like the tang of classic yellow, but use your fave)

How to Make Healthy Thanksgiving The Ultimate Smash Burger
Alright, let’s get smashing! I promise this is easier than wrestling with a turkey – and way more fun. Follow these steps and you’ll have perfect burgers in no time.
Step 1: Prepare the Beef Mixture
First things first – dump that beautiful lean ground beef into a bowl. Now sprinkle in all your flavor buddies: garlic powder, onion powder, black pepper, and salt. Here’s my trick – I mix with my hands (clean ones, obviously!) until everything’s evenly distributed. You want every bite to sing with flavor, so no lazy stirring!
Step 2: Shape and Smash the Patties
Divide your beef mixture into four equal balls – about the size of a lime each. Now here comes the fun part! Get your skillet screaming hot, then plop a ball in and immediately SMASH it with your spatula. Press down hard and fast – we’re talking quarter-inch thin here. The thinner, the crispier, the better!
Step 3: Cook to Perfection
Let those patties sizzle for 3-4 minutes undisturbed – you’ll see the edges getting all lacy and golden. Flip them like you mean it, then cook another 3-4 minutes. Pro tip: give them one more good press after flipping for extra crispiness. You’ll hear the sizzle of approval!
Step 4: Assemble the Burgers
While the patties rest (yes, even burgers need a minute!), lightly toast those whole wheat buns in the skillet’s residual heat – just 1-2 minutes. Now build your masterpiece: smear on that tangy mayo-mustard mix, pile high with fresh veggies, and crown it with your crispy patty. Get ready for your new favorite Thanksgiving bite!
Tips for the Best Healthy Thanksgiving The Ultimate Smash Burger
Want to take your smash burgers from good to “Oh my gravy!” good? Here are my hard-earned secrets:
- Cast-iron is queen – that heavy pan gives you the perfect crust we all crave. No cast-iron? Any heavy skillet will do in a pinch.
- Double press magic – smash when you flip too! Extra pressure means extra crispy edges. You can thank me later.
- Turkey twist – swap in lean ground turkey if you prefer, just add an extra pinch of seasoning to keep it flavorful.
- Don’t crowd the pan – cook in batches if needed. These burgers need their personal space to get properly crisp.
Ingredient Substitutions for Healthy Thanksgiving The Ultimate Smash Burger
Listen, I get it – sometimes you gotta work with what you’ve got! Here’s how to tweak this burger without losing that Thanksgiving magic:
- Turkey instead of beef? Go for it! Just use 93% lean ground turkey and bump up the seasonings a bit – it’s a tad milder in flavor.
- Out of mayo? Greek yogurt mixed with mustard gives the same tang with extra protein.
- Gluten-free needs? Any sturdy GF bun works, though I love butter lettuce wraps for an ultra-light option.
The key is keeping that perfect smash and crispiness – everything else is flexible!

Storage and Reheating Instructions
Okay, confession time – these burgers are so good they rarely last long in my house! But if you’ve got leftovers (lucky you), here’s the deal: separate the patties from the buns and store them in airtight containers in the fridge for 2-3 days max. When you’re ready for round two, skip the microwave – just reheat those patties in a hot skillet for a minute each side to bring back that perfect crisp. The buns? Quick toast and boom – good as new!

FAQs About Healthy Thanksgiving The Ultimate Smash Burger
Can I use frozen ground beef?
Absolutely! Just thaw it completely in the fridge first. Frozen beef tends to release more moisture, so pat it dry with paper towels before mixing with seasonings. This helps prevent steaming when you smash those patties.
What’s the best way to make this gluten-free?
Easy peasy! Swap the whole wheat buns for your favorite gluten-free version – just make sure they’re sturdy enough to handle the juicy patty. My personal favorite? Toasting gluten-free buns extra crispy or using large butter lettuce leaves as wraps.
Can I prep the patties ahead of time?
You bet! Mix and shape the beef balls up to a day in advance, then store them covered in the fridge. Just wait to smash and cook them right before serving – that crispy crust is worth the wait!
Why lean beef instead of regular?
Trust me, 90% lean gives you all that beefy flavor without the grease pool in your skillet. The leaner meat also sticks less to your spatula when smashing – meaning perfect, intact patties every time!

20-Minute Healthy Thanksgiving Smash Burgers – Guilt-Free Bliss
- Total Time: 20 mins
- Yield: 4 burgers
- Diet: Low Fat
Description
A delicious and healthy smash burger recipe perfect for Thanksgiving, packed with flavor and easy to make.
Ingredients
- 1 lb lean ground beef (90% lean)
- 1 tsp olive oil
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p onion powder
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 4 whole wheat burger buns
- 1 cup mixed greens
- 1 tomato, sliced
- 1/4 cup red onion, thinly sliced
- 1/4 cup low-fat mayonnaise
- 1 tbsp mustard
Instructions
- Heat a skillet or griddle over medium-high heat.
- In a bowl, mix ground beef with garlic powder, onion powder, black pepper, and salt.
- Divide the beef into 4 equal portions and shape into balls.
- Place each ball on the hot skillet and press down firmly with a spatula to create a thin patty.
- Cook for 3-4 minutes per side until fully browned and cooked through.
- Toast the buns lightly for 1-2 minutes.
- Assemble the burgers with patties, mixed greens, tomato, red onion, mayonnaise, and mustard.
- Serve immediately.
Notes
- Use a cast-iron skillet for better sear.
- For extra crispiness, press the patties again after flipping.
- Substitute ground turkey for a leaner option.
